I'm in the USA.

That's a great site but how do you tell which ones are MFM?

They don't list it in the descriptions...

I thought the max for an ST was 100 meg or so?

- - - - - -

No, the limit for the oldest stock STs is 14 BGM partitions (C: - P:) of 256 MB each. There is a need with some old (very old) software to run off of a TOS partition, which has a limit of 16MB (32MB with later Ataris). Since it is often considered a good idea to keep your boot progams separate from your work programs, many of us still use a 16MB boot partition, even though we have no physical need to do so. Even with 50 fonts, I only have 13MB in my boot partition.
